EXAMINE THIS REPORT ON WHAT IS MD5'S APPLICATION

Examine This Report on what is md5's application

Examine This Report on what is md5's application

Blog Article

What is MD5 Authentication? Message-Digest Algorithm five (MD5) can be a hash perform that generates a hash value that is often precisely the same from a specified string or concept. MD5 can be utilized for many applications for example checking down load information or storing passwords.

A precomputed desk for reversing cryptographic hash functions, generally accustomed to crack MD5 hashes by looking up the corresponding input for just a hash worth.

User credential (which refers to username and password combinations utilized for accessing on the internet accounts) are quite sensitive information sets that need to always be shielded.

Since engineering will not be likely any where and does much more excellent than damage, adapting is the greatest study course of motion. That is where The Tech Edvocate comes in. We plan to include the PreK-12 and Higher Schooling EdTech sectors and provide our viewers with the newest information and view on the subject.

MD5 is additionally Employed in password hashing, in which it can be used to convert plaintext passwords into cryptographically safe hashes that could be saved in a database for later on comparison.

Pre-Picture Resistance: MD5 isn't immune to pre-image attacks (the ability to find an enter corresponding to a presented hash) when compared to much more modern hashing algorithms.

Once more, we must split up the Procedure into sections, for the reason that this calculator doesn’t allow parentheses either.

Although MD5 is largely deemed insecure for crucial stability applications, it remains to be utilised in certain area of interest situations or legacy programs where by safety demands are decreased, or its vulnerabilities will not be immediately exploitable. Here are some situations wherever MD5 authentication remains to be encountered:

Automatic Salting: Deliver a unique random salt for each person or piece of info. Most recent hashing libraries manage this quickly.

MD5 can be prone to pre-image assaults, in which an attacker can find an input website that generates a selected hash worth. To put it differently, offered an MD5 hash, it’s computationally possible for an attacker to reverse-engineer and locate an enter that matches that hash.

The length of the initial concept is then appended to the end from the padded information. Initialization: MD5 initializes four 32-little bit variables (A, B, C, D) to unique regular values. These variables act given that the Preliminary hash values, and also the RSA Algorithm takes advantage of them to course of action the info in the subsequent techniques.

MD5 was as soon as a popular option for hashing passwords resulting from its simplicity. On the other hand, on account of vulnerabilities like rainbow table assaults and hash collisions, MD5 is now not regarded safe for password hashing. Much more strong algorithms like bcrypt and Argon2 are actually advisable.

The review of examining cryptographic techniques to find weaknesses or split them. MD5 has been subject matter to extensive cryptanalysis.

In a very collision attack, an attacker attempts to discover two distinctive inputs (Permit’s contact them A and B) that develop exactly the same hash benefit utilizing MD5. When prosperous, the attacker can substitute A with B with out transforming the hash value.

Report this page